School Description
School Summary and Highlights
- Enrolls 325 elementary school students from grades KG-6
- Ranks 246th out of 365 elementary schools in ID.
Additional Contact Information
- Principal or Admin: Greg Kramasz
- Fax: (208) 748-3649
School Operational Details
- Title I EligibleAll students of this school are eligible for participation in authorized programs.
School District Details
- Lewiston Independent School District
- Per-Pupil Spending: $8,071
- Graduation Rate: 84.4%
- Dropout Rate: 2.1%
- Students Per Teacher: 17.3
- Enrolled Students: 4,953
Faculty Details and Student Enrollment
Students and Faculty
- Total Students Enrolled: 325
-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 17.6
-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 18.5
Students Gender Breakdown
- Males: 173 (53.2%)
- Females: 152 (46.8%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
-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 51 (15.7%)
- Eligible for Free Lunch: 119 (36.6%)
-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 170 (52.3%)
